After beating Paris Saint-Germain in the first leg (3-2), FC Barcelona thought they had taken a big step towards qualification by opening the score in the 12th minute this evening. But the expulsion of Ronald Araujo changed the match. Outnumbered, the Spanish club suffered the law of the Ile-de-France club before losing 4-1 and therefore saying goodbye to the C1. And for Jules Koundé, the red of Araujo is having trouble getting through.

“We are disappointed, we started the match well, we led 1-0. Afterwards, an incident in the game (the expulsion of Araujo) complicated the match for us. Being 10 among 11 for 70 minutes is complicated against a team of this level. We had opportunities to get back into the match. Everything is more complicated at 10 against 11. It’s not about merit, it’s about the details. We had a very good match in the first leg, we showed that we were capable of competing. We win, we lose as a team. We’re not here to point the finger at anyone, but playing 10 against 11 is too hard. We have two, three actions that don’t go far. With the numerical superiority (of PSG), it was more difficult to get the balls out. We tried, but honestly, it was difficult with ten of us”he confided to the microphone of Canal+.
